이미 다운로드 한 macOS High Sierra 설치 프로그램 이미지에 최신 보안 패치 (APFS 일반 비밀번호 취약성)를 포함시키는 방법은 무엇입니까?


1

몇 시간 전에 Apple은 "일반 텍스트에 암호화 된 APFS 볼륨의 비밀번호를 노출시키는 취약점"문제를 해결하는 macOS 용 수정 업데이트를 발표했습니다.

내 질문은 :

High Sierra를 사용할 수있게 되 자마자 설치 관리자 (오른쪽 아래 모서리의 마지막 아이콘)를 당겼습니다.

나는 가정 이 파일이 있음을 하지 않는 수정이 생성되기 전에 출시 / 다운로드 한 이후 최근 패치가 포함되어 있습니다. 이제 부팅 가능한 USB 플래시 드라이브를 만들고 다른 MacBook에이 버전의 High Sierra를 설치하는 것처럼 가정합니다. 수정 사항을 얻으려면 App Store로 이동하여 업데이트를 검색해야하지만 이론적으로 Mac에 인터넷이 연결되어 있지 않으면 어떻게됩니까?

정확한 질문 : 항상 최신 수정 프로그램으로 설치 프로그램을 얻는 방법은 무엇입니까? /Applications새 부 버전 ( 10.13.X)이 출시 될 때마다 해당 파일을 제거했다가 다시 다운로드해야 합니까?

내 주요 Mac에서 High Sierra는 버전이 지정 10.13되었지만 업데이트를 설치 한 후에는 버전이 변경되지 않은 것으로 나타났습니다 . 아닙니다 10.13.1.

여기에 이미지 설명을 입력하십시오

답변:


3

업데이트를 이전 macOS 설치 프로그램으로 쉽게 병합 할 수 없습니다. 따라서 최신 버전을 얻으려면 전체 설치 관리자를 다시 다운로드해야합니다. 제한된 (20MB) 설치 프로그램 전용 앱이 없는지 확인하십시오.

첫 번째 전체 설치 프로그램을 다운로드 한 후 (설치하지 않고) 폴더로 이동하고 폴더를 선택하는 dmg를 생성하거나 앱을 압축합니다.

그런 다음 업그레이드를 설치하거나 macOS installer.app를 휴지통에 버립니다.

Apple이 새로운 설치 프로그램을 발표하고 발표 한 후 (포인트 릴리스 업데이트 일 필요는 없음) 다시 다운로드하십시오. 위 단계를 반복하십시오. 이전 installer.dmg가 더 이상 필요하지 않으면 휴지통을 비우십시오. 나는 보통 그들을 유지합니다.


특정 상황에서 (종종 macOS installer.app를 임의의 폴더로 이동 한 후) 새 릴리스를 다운로드하면 이전 macOS 설치 프로그램이 대신 설치됩니다.


빌드 버전 grep을 확인하려면 DTSDKBuild의 /Contents/Info.plist 파일을 확인하십시오 .

grep DTSDKBuild -A1 .../Install\ macOS\ High\ Sierra.app/Contents/Info.plist

골든 마스터의 빌드 버전은 17A362a 입니다.

공개적으로 사용할 수있는 첫 번째 설치 프로그램의 빌드 버전은 17A364 입니다.

현재 최신 빌드 버전은 17A400 (작은 설치 프로그램) 또는 17A403 (큰 설치 프로그램)입니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.